Chandrakant Pandit resigns as Kolkata Knight Riders head coach after three-year tenure


Chandrakant Pandit has resigned as Kolkata Knight Riders head coach after a three-year stint with the Indian Premier League franchise. The announcement was made by the franchise through social media on Tuesday, mentioning that he is looking to explore new opportunities going forward.
Kolkata Knight Riders head coach Chandrakant Pandit has parted ways after a three-year stint with the three-time IPL champions. The 63-year-old former Indian cricketer was last seen coaching the team in the 2025 season of the IPL, where the side was led by star Indian middle-order batter Ajinkya Rahane. The franchise announced his departure through a post on social media, where they thanked him for his services.
“Mr. Chandrakant Pandit has decided to explore new opportunities and will not continue as head coach of Kolkata Knight Riders. We are thankful for his invaluable contributions - including leading KKR to the IPL championship in 2024 and helping build a strong, resilient squad. His leadership and discipline left a lasting impact on the team,” the statement read.
Pandit joined the Knight Riders in August 2022, when the side was led by Shreyas Iyer. The first two years of his tenure were a struggle. Though the side showed a lot of potential in the 2022 and 2023 seasons, they failed to make it into the playoffs, finishing seventh on both occasions. However, he made sure the team came back stronger in 2024 and won their third IPL title after a 10-year gap.
Though Pandit’s future is still undetermined, one of his trusted coaching staff members, Abhishek Nayar, is expected to undertake a prominent role with the franchise. Nayar was the assistant coach of the team from 2018 to 2024 before his short stint with the Indian cricket team. After his contract was terminated, Nayar returned with the Boys in Gold and Purple midway through the IPL 2025 season. He was recently appointed as UP Warriorz coach for the upcoming season of the Women’s Premier League.
